Gracie Fields in France FORCES SWEETHEARTS at the Queen’s Theatre, Friday December 20, 2.15

Beryl Korman and Carolyn Allen, both seasoned TV and west end performers, bring an afternoon of nostalgia with a parade of songs and melodies that made war time Britain just that little more palatable.

They relive the time when stars of stage, screen and film, joined together to entertain the troops in many theatres or war.

With that picture in mind, Beryl and Carolyn bring their show ‘Forces Sweethearts’ to Hornchurch just in time for Christmas with the duo parading a full repertoire out of their kit bag from, ‘All I Want For Christmas’, ‘White Cliffs of Dover’ to the Andrews Sisters big hit with the Glen Miller Orchestra, ‘Chattanooga Choo Choo’.

Accompanied by Paul Smith and Will Hill on the drums, past performances have rated high on the emotional scale and the odd ream of Kleenex is regarded as essential

The show is two hours packed with songs and melodies that reminded the troops of the homes they left behind, and those at home of loved ones fighting for their country.
